Economic Impact of the Tour de France Grand Départ in Edinburgh - Announcing the exciting news that Edinburgh, Scotland's stunning capital city, will host the prestigious Tour de France Grand Départ in 2027! This momentous event promises to bring international acclaim, significant economic benefits, and a surge of cycling enthusiasm to the city and the entire nation. The event is set to be a landmark moment for Scottish cycling and tourism, leaving an enduring legacy for years to come.

The Cycling Route and Stage Details for Edinburgh

While precise details are yet to be officially released, speculation around the Tour de France Edinburgh route is rife with excitement. The Grand Départ stages are anticipated to showcase Edinburgh's iconic landmarks, providing breathtaking backdrops for the world's best cyclists.

  • Potential Routes: Potential routes might include stretches along the Royal Mile, offering stunning views of Edinburgh Castle, and incorporating the picturesque landscapes surrounding the city. The route could potentially weave through Holyrood Park, showcasing Arthur's Seat's majestic silhouette, and possibly include sections along the Water of Leith, embracing Edinburgh's beautiful green spaces.

  • Stage Length and Difficulty: The stage(s) starting in Edinburgh are likely to be challenging yet exhilarating, incorporating a blend of flat sections and potentially some demanding climbs, showcasing the diverse terrain of Scotland. The exact length and difficulty will only be confirmed closer to the event date.

  • Inclusion of Surrounding Scottish Areas: The route may extend beyond Edinburgh's city limits, potentially incorporating picturesque areas of the Scottish countryside, providing a further boost to Scottish cycling routes and Edinburgh cycling tourism. This will allow cyclists and spectators to experience the beauty of Scotland beyond the city limits.
